Ventilation systems function by promoting air circulation that expels heated air from your attic space. During summer months, roof spaces can exceed 130-160°F, which forces your HVAC system to operate less efficiently.
The fundamental principle of attic ventilation involves creating a continuous airflow system that removes hot air from your attic space while drawing in cooler outside air. This process, known as the stack effect, occurs naturally when intake vents (typically located in soffits) allow cool air to enter while exhaust vents (like attic fans or ridge vents) remove heated air. Solar Attic Fans: Eco-Friendly and Cost-Effective
The technology behind modern solar attic fans has advanced significantly, with current models featuring high-efficiency photovoltaic panels that operate effectively even in partial sunlight conditions. Many units include battery backup systems that provide continued operation during cloudy periods or evening hours when attic heat buildup remains problematic. For Wisconsin residents, solar attic fans qualify for federal tax credits of up to 30% of installation costs, and some utility companies offer additional rebates for energy-efficient home improvements.
Professional Grade Systems
Electric attic fans provide the highest air movement capacity and most consistent performance for 53005 homes requiring maximum ventilation power. These systems typically move 1,000-2,400 cubic feet of air per minute, making them ideal for larger homes or attics with complex layouts that require additional airflow capacity.
